A national care and support organization in the United Kingdom is seeking a Head of Safety and Risk to lead safety management across the organization. This pivotal role involves contributing to the senior leadership team and ensuring compliance with health and safety standards.

Ideal candidates are experienced Health and Safety professionals eager for a position that combines strategic oversight with operational duties. The organization has over 5,000 employees and is dedicated to maintaining high safety standards.
